Additional file 5: Table S2. Detailed whole genome comparison data. Percentage identity and percentage coverage values for the ANIb and ANIm approaches as well as percentage identity for the dDDH approach. Taxonomic classification of strains 869â T2, DS 22E-1 and DWS 37E-2 based on their genomic alignment with B. seminalis, B. pseudomultivorans and B. latens respectively as estimated by ANIb.
